At the beginning of an experiment, a scientist has 248 grams of radioactive goo. After 210 minutes, her sample has decayed to 31 grams. What is the half-life of the goo in minutes? Find a formula for G(t), the amount of goo remaining at time t. G(t) How many grams of goo will remain after 62 minutes? You may enter the exact value or round to 2 decimal places.
